Quick overview

Doge’s Palace is one of Venice’s busiest paid sights. On busy days, same-day ticket buyers typically face around 30–60 minutes at the ticket office and, at peak midday in high season, surveys show that can stretch to roughly 70–110 minutes, plus about 10–20 minutes more at security. All visitors must clear the same security checkpoint, so skip-the-line options mainly cut the ticket-purchase wait and reduce the risk of sold-out slots.

What does skip-the-line really mean for the Doge’s Palace?

Skip-the-line tickets to the Doge’s Palace let you bypass the long queue at the ticket office and enter through a faster, dedicated line. However, you’ll still go through standard security checks, which are mandatory for all visitors. These tickets help you save 30 minutes to 2 hours in peak season and let you explore the palace at your own pace or with a guide.

How long are the queues at the Doge’s Palace entrance?

The Doge’s Palace attracts roughly around 3,500 visitors a day, making queues a regular part of the experience.

  • From April to October, wait times can stretch from 45 to 120 minutes, with the longest delays between 10am and 1pm, when cruise passengers and tour groups arrive in large numbers. 
  • Even during the off-season, lines of 20–40 minutes are typical on weekends and late mornings. 

These queues start forming at the main courtyard entrance and often spill into St. Mark’s Square, creating bottlenecks near the ticket counters and slowing down entry for everyone, particularly during the midday heat.

Type of queues at the Doge's Palace

Entry to the Palace is through Porta del Frumento (Grain Gateway), located in the Piazzetta, San Marco 1 , 30124 Venezia VE, Italy.

Ticketing queue

Location: Outside Porta del Frumento, under the colonnade facing Riva degli Schiavoni

Who it’s for: Visitors purchasing tickets on the spot

Average wait time: Up to 45–90 minutes during peak season, shorter (20–40 minutes) off-peak

Skip-the-line? Can be bypassed with pre-booked tickets

Ticket redemption queue

Location: Just inside Porta del Frumento, in the main courtyard near ticket scanning kiosks

Who it’s for: Visitors with advance (online) tickets needing validation

Average wait time: Short, typically 5–25 minutes, even at peak hours

Skip-the-line?  Yes – significantly faster than the walk-up queue

Security check queue

Location: Immediately after ticket validation, just beyond the main entrance inside the courtyard

Who it’s for: All visitors

Average wait time: 10–20 mins (peak), 5–10 mins (off‑peak)

Skip-the-line?  No – mandatory for everyone

Guided tour queue

Location: At a designated check-in point near Porta della Carta (the ornate ceremonial gateway next to the main entrance)

Who it’s for: Guests on guided tours

Average wait time: 3–10 mins—significantly faster than general lines

Skip-the-Line?  Yes – priority scanning and escorted entry

4. Time your visit smartly

To avoid peak crowds, arrive by 8:45am to be among the first inside when the Palace opens at 9am, or visit after 4pm when tour groups begin to leave. Steer clear of weekends, public holidays (like April 25, June 2, and Ferragosto), and Tuesdays, which see higher traffic due to Monday museum closures.
